Paul Bernardo and Karla Homolka’s wedding day was a lavish affair -- horse-drawn carriage and all. While their guests toasted the happy couple’s new life together, fishermen and boaters on Lake Gibson were making a gruesome discovery: human remains encased in cement - 10 pieces in all. Those remains belonged to 14-year-old Leslie Mahaffy, who had gone missing from the backyard of her family’s home. She wasn’t the first teenager to die at the hands of Paul and Karla -- and she wouldn’t be the last.
